Just completed 3 years on a trust deed and 3 years paying back equity. Am I right in thinking that everything falls off your file after 6 years. My trust deed started on 24th June 2011 so is it fair to assume I will have nothing showing after 24th June 2017 or do we have to wait for discharge from trustee before we are clear? Thanks
Hi Cody,
Anything that goes on your credit file stays there for six years, then falls off.
You'd need to look at your credit file and see what has been put on there and when it was put there.
For example, if a creditor issued a default notice a year after your trust deed began then it would remain on your credit file for a year longer. I wouldn't assume that something like this hasn't happened, but hopefully it will turn out that it hasn't.
Trustee discharge should be irrelevant, but sometimes certain creditors appear to consider that the date they get paid is relevant in terms of your credit file. It isn't - it's the date of your discharge that's relevant.
In short, you may need to intervene if something isn't being reported correctly.
